Sony launches ICD-TX660 voice recorder with a lightweight and ultra-thin design for Rs. 11,670

spot_img

Sony India today announced a new addition to its voice recorder range with ICD-TX660. The TX660 offers high quality and reliable recording with one push and auto voice recording. Its improved features and premium design make it an ideal device to carry in your pocket for on-the-go recording.

The ICD-TX660 has 16GB of built-in memory, so you have plenty of storage space for your audio. Record and store up to 5000 separate files. The improved Digital Stereo Mic of the voice recorder now reduces the noise by 50 % without sacrificing the microphone sensitivity.

With 41% large and improved OLED display, it makes the text legible to read.  You can keep track of your recordings and read text more easily than ever. The ICD-TX660 has a USB Type-C port for convenient connectivity.

Price and Availability

The new ICD-TX660 voice recorder speaker will be available across Sony retail stores (Sony Center and Sony Exclusive), www.ShopatSC.com portal, major electronic stores and on Amazon and Flipkart portal in India from 27th September 2021 onwards.
